signal brief

TSMC reported a 67.9% year-on-year surge in June revenue to NT$442.68 billion, with first-half revenue up 35.6% to NT$2.4 trillion, exceeding high-end guidance (Source: CNBC). The company also announced plans to add two advanced packaging plants in Chiayi Science Park, with all four plants expected to generate over $9.35B in annual output (Source: Reuters). SemiAnalysis analyst Sravan Kundojjala noted that TSMC's Q2 revenue exceeded its high-end guidance and that AI demand remains tight, with N3 capacity sold out (Source: CNBC). TSMC's CoWoS bottlenecks are redirecting work to other players, but TSMC maintains a dominant 73% pure-foundry market share (Source: Digitimes). These developments underscore TSMC's central role in AI infrastructure spending and strong demand momentum ahead of its July 16 earnings call.
